The Book of Sitra Achra – N. 218 Revised & Expanded Azerate Pact Edition Satanic Qliphoth Grimoire Ixaxaar TOTBL/TFC Liber Falxifer Occult Qayinite Sorcery. The Book of Sitra Achra. A Grimoire of the Dragons of the Other Side. The Book of Sitra Achra – A Grimoire of the Dragons of the Other Side. The Book of Sitra Achra is the first complete and completely Qliphothic Grimoire giving insight into a Gnostic Luciferian-Satanic (Lucifer and Satan being contextually the titles of the Illuminator/Destroyer aspects of the Other God) facet of Ceremonial Magic with the aim to thwart the Demiurge and his Archons and give access to the Divinity, or Side of the Divine, that does not merely condemn but also actively oppose the Fall of All That Is (including itself) from the Pleroma of Ain (Fullness of Emptiness). Within this text structured in a form similar to many of the Classic Grimoires something unique is presented, as masked by the sometimes familiar names, words and forms, a very Alien Essence is brought forth and to those that can resonate with its Hidden and Wordless Gospel of the Thoughtless God, manifested within the unwritten silence in-between that which is spelled out, the Keys to the Kingdom Within, leading to the Outside/Other Side, are made accessible. The Book of Sitra Achra offers a modality of Gnostic Nihilistic Theurgy, codified and disclosed through Qliphothic Sorcery and while the outer structure of the work is that of a Handbook of Nigromancy i. Black Divination, or here more correctly a Divining with the Black Light, evocation and “Infernal Pact Making”, the inner core that the chosen few are lead to discover, by the progression of their own Solitary Initiation based on the Work outlined in this book, is nothing less than a Path to and an Alchemical Process of Acosmic Transcendence, for the Conquering of Cosmic Heimarmene and the Liberation of All through the Wrathful and Thoughtless Compassion of the Other God/s. This Grimoire of the Dragons of the Other Side offers the foundation for a radical form of Gnostic Magic and Spirituality in which the Archonic forces are not approached in a passive manner and instead opposed forcefully i. Satanically, as a response to that which would not be receptive for Luciferian Illumination/Salvation, with the aid of the Side of Divinity to whom that which within the Current 218 is coined as the “Death Drive of God, the Will to Nihil or the Ainic Inclination” (the Impulse to Return All back into Unmanifest Mystery) resonating within those that would be as Giants in the Face of the Demiurge, have its ultimate source. Here the Forbidden Gnosis of the Silencers of God is codified in myth, formulas, seals and rituals, making available points of ingress to those very few that share in the Will of Azerate Elohim Acherim, being the Anti-Demiurgic Impulse of Ain Sof Aur, through which the End can become attained as the beginning of the reintegration of All within the Fullness of Emptiness and the redemption of the Divine Sparks imprisoned within the Hylic Worlds of White Darkness. A Genesis Account, describing the emanation of Ain Sof from the Primal Ain and the division so created within the Divinity in still Unmanifest Form and the Cause of Duality within the imperfect fallen state from the Holy Fullness of the Emptiness. Recounting the process of the creation and its antithesis, the germination of the Tree of Life and the Tree of Death, the Uprising of the Thoughtless Worlds, the Shattering of the Vessels of the Thoughtful, the becoming of the Abyss, the creation of the Edenic Daath, the Intrusion of the Bringer of Forbidden Wisdom, the Fall of Man by the Fruit of Forbidden Knowledge and the Raising of the Children of the Serpent. Revealing the identity of the True God of those that would follow That Other Light, explaining the two aspects of the Tetragrammaton, being the YHVH on this side and the HVHY on the Other Side, making known the El of Qliphoth and disclosing its Elevenfoldness, taking form as the Azerate, whose name is examined and some of the fundamental mysteries of Divinity Manifested Through 218 for the first time disclosed. An initial and introductory presentation of the Ten Qliphoth headed by the Eleven, providing their Operative Seals and Formulae through which the Fruits of the Tree of Death can be reached and harvested. Disclosing in detail for the first time the nature and identity of the Rulers of the Other Side, being the Eleven Crowned Heads of the Thoughtless Dragon, without falling into the trap of syncretism based on etymology and mundane archaeology, explaining instead their attribution and essences as relevant to Context, Current and Tradition, rendering not only their esoteric attribution but also their Secret Throne Seals, Angle Keys and Formulae of Calling, by which they can be Invoked, Enthroned within and without and allowed to Illuminate or Annihilate. An extensive presentation of an esoteric aspect of the Qliphothic Daemonology, introducing for the first time the 60 Harbingers of the Black Light, being the active forces of the Ten Qliphoth belonging to the Eleven Rulers and invested with the powers of all the Dragons of the Other Side. Provided together with all of their names, seals and relevant attribution, allowing them to be approached within the Initiatic Work of the Qliphothic Adept climbing the Tree of Death for the sake of the Thoughtless and Lawless Rectification of Divine Nihility, leading Spirit back towards its Source beyond and before the fallen state of creator and creation. An essential unveiling of the Letters of the Alphabet of the Other God, being the 22 letters of the Silencing Alogos uttered by the Thoughtless Divinity in order to quieten and counteract the Logos of the Creator, presented in detail, with not only their esoteric attribution as related to the Qliphothic Work given but also with the seal of each of their individual Daemon governing a corresponding branch upon the Tree of Death, making it possible to employ these letters within the context of both practical Sorcery, Spiritual Alchemy and Qliphothic Transcendental Theurgy. A practical presentation of the 12 rulers of the Qliphothic Zodiac, providing their list of correspondences, attributes, symbolic forms, incense formulae, sympathetic elements, esoteric seals and much more, allowing the Qliphothic Adept to reach these forces countering the cosmic fate with their Chaos, making possible the liberation from the chains of the personal horoscope and the transcending of the tyrannical rule of the Archonic Destiny. Providing also the clues for the correct approach towards the creation of fetishes and talismans imbued with the powers of these 12 Princes of the Qliphothic Zodiac. A revealing presentation of the so called Seven Hells, more correctly addressed as the Seven Kingdoms of the Qliphoth, showing them to be much more than what they often have been described as, separating them fully from the places of punishment under the dominion of the YHVH. These Seven Hells or Kingdoms of the Eleven are presented from the initiatic perspective together with their Hell Gate Seals and Opening Formulae, allowing the Qliphothic Adept the means to open up and enter each of them within the context of the Thoughtless and Lawless Becoming of the Children of the Serpent. An instructive presentation of a working aimed at the opening of the Astral Points of the Seven Gates, outlining the work as a very potent and practical initial approach towards these mysteries, upon which much more advanced workings can be built in order to allow for the unlocking of the Gates of the Seven Kingdoms of the Dragons on all levels of existence. The first public and a most extensive treatment of the esoteric application of the different aspects of the Hendecagram as employed within the Esoteric Work of our Tradition, being the Star Seal of the Qliphoth and their Ruler Azerate, laying out the whole foundation of a system of Qliphothic Magic through the establishment and different modes of activation of the Eleven Primal Seed Points reflecting the Black Light, which is made to shine through the manifesting rays in order to cause unfated intrusions of the Forces of the Other Side. The Stars of Invocation, Evocation, Egress, Ingress and Transcendence needed for the accomplishment of many of the workings of this Grimoire of the Dragons of Qliphoth are all presented and made available to those that would be willing and able to put them to proper use. An extensive treatment and presentation of the tools of the practice with their esoteric attribution disclosed, in a form unrelated to the regurgitated concepts connected to similar items as most often found within Western texts concerning magic, here explained in aspects specifically related to the Qliphoth, its Rulers and Emissaries, together with their modes of initial purification, consecration and correct and effective employment and much more, which by the Eleven Topics addressed and covered give the student of the Book of Sitra Achra the means to initiate the Great Work, which is the only actual way to gain from that which is disclosed in this Grimoire, as only through concrete and hard practice will its contents open up as the Gates of Becoming, leading the Blood of the Nachashel back towards its Source of Holiness. Being the Initiatory Procedure for entering into the Elevenfold Covenant with the Roshim ha-Azerate, being the Governing Heads of the Qliphoth for the sake of a Permanent Spiritual Enlinkment to and Through the Current 218 and the Thoughtless Black Light of God. These Eleven Covenants are each outlined as the culmination of a monthly work of Qliphothic Theurgy, leading to the establishing of the contact needed for the validation and sealing of each Covenant of Death, which if entered into wholeheartedly and accepted by the Other Side will kill aspects of the Clay-Born ego that constitutes the different parts of the Sephirothic Kelim confining the Spirit to the Demiurgic realm. These Eleven covenants are then Concluded and made as One by and within the Azerate Pact, which also is outlined in detail, with suggestion for creating talismans and enlinkments to the Work in question, empowered by the forces generated through the procedures of the 11 Covenants and the One Pact with Azerate El Acher. The conclusion of the Initiatic Work made available throughout this Grimoire of the Dragons of the Other Side, where the Logos is made Alogos and the Thoughtless Silence and Silencing force made manifest as the 56 Kelimic Seals presented to those that attain the Insights and Empowerments of the 11=1=11 made attainable through the 11+1 chapters preceding this 13th and final one, giving here the means for the Mirroring Addition of the Power of Spirit to establish the Bridges to the Other Side. By the 56 Reflective Sigillic Kelim the Black Light Within can be connected to the One Without and so strenghten the Ingressive and Egressive Points, through which the Fires of the Eleven-Headed Dragon can be cultivated, doubled and allowed to burn all that is not of its own Black Flames. Within this final chapter the Beginning of the End is provided to those that via Actual Gnosis learn to understand its hidden meaning, implications and applications. The mysteries here will be barred to all but the Faithful that can glance them not with eyes of man but with the Restored Sight of the Awakened Dragon.
